[Healthchecks](https://github.com/healthchecks/healthchecks) is a watchdog for your cron jobs. It's a web server that listens for pings from your cron jobs, plus a web interface.

Docker images are configured using parameters passed at runtime (such as those above). These parameters are separated by a colon and indicate `<external>:<internal>` respectively. For example, `-p 8080:80` would expose port `80` from inside the container to be accessible from the host's IP on port `8080` outside the container.
| `SITE_ROOT=` | The site's top-level URL and the port it listens to if differrent than 80 or 443 (e.g., https://healthchecks.example.com:8000) |
| `SITE_NAME=` | The site's name (e.g., "Example Corp HealthChecks") |
| `DEFAULT_FROM_EMAIL=` | From email for alerts |
| `EMAIL_HOST=` | SMTP host |
| `EMAIL_PORT=` | SMTP port |
| `EMAIL_HOST_USER=` | SMTP user |
| `EMAIL_HOST_PASSWORD=` | SMTP password |
| `EMAIL_USE_TLS=` | Use TLS for SMTP (`True` or `False`) |
| `SUPERUSER_EMAIL=` | Superuser email |
| `SUPERUSER_PASSWORD=` | Superuser password |
| `REGENERATE_SETTINGS=` | Defaults to False. Set to true to always override the `local_settings.py` file with values from environment variables. Do not set to True if you have made manual modifications to this file. |
| `SITE_LOGO_URL=` | Full URL to custom site logo |
| `ALLOWED_HOSTS=` | Array of valid hostnames for the server `["test.com","test2.com"]` (default: `["*"]`) |
| `SECRET_KEY=` | A secret key used for cryptographic signing. Will generate a secure value if one is not supplied |
| `APPRISE_ENABLED=` | Defaults to False. A boolean that turns on/off the Apprise integration (https://github.com/caronc/apprise) |
| `DEBUG=` | Defaults to True. Debug mode relaxes CSRF protections and increases logging verbosity but should be disabled for production instances as it will impact performance and security. |
For all of our images we provide the ability to override the default umask settings for services started within the containers using the optional `-e UMASK=022` setting.
Keep in mind umask is not chmod it subtracts from permissions based on it's value it does not add. Please read up [here](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Umask) before asking for support.
When using volumes (`-v` flags), permissions issues can arise between the host OS and the container, we avoid this issue by allowing you to specify the user `PUID` and group `PGID`.
